  2. Torrey Pines High School is a high school in the North County Coastal area of San Diego, California.The school is named after the Torrey pine tree that grows in the area. . Torrey Pines High School is a member of the San Dieguito Union High School District and serves the communities of Rancho Santa Fe, Del Mar, Fairbanks Ranch, Solana Beach, and Carmel Valley in San Diego Co
